I did some research... place these in your tips page if you desire Crash...

Format: Stage-Klaxes-Diagonals-Tiles-Points-Horizontal

1-3-5K-3D-10000-40T<br>
6-10-6-55-25000-5<br>
11-15-13-75-25000-10<br>
16-15-13-75-30000-13<br>
21-20-13-65-35000-13<br>
26-30-13-80-35000-15<br>
31-30-13-90-40000-5<br>
36-30-13-90-40000-15<br>
41-35-13-90-50000-15<br>
46-35-13-90-55000-18<br>
51-30-13-90-60000-18<br>
56-30-5-90-60000-18<br>
61-30-15-90-70000-13<br>
66-30-15-100-70000-15<br>
71-35-13-100-75000-15<br>
76-22-6-100-80000-20<br>
81-40-20-100-100000-5<br>
86-30-20-100-100000-20<br>
91-25-13-100-70000-15<br>
96-30-6-50-6H-250000P

ST - starting wave in the 5 wave sequence (if 6, it would cover waves 6 - 10)<br>
K - Klaxes<br>
D - Diagonals<br>
T - Tile Survival Wave<br>
P - Points<br>
H - Horizontal<br>

It's like the format unless noted (series 1 and 96)

Speed of tiles is allways the same at same stage, your speed at
previous level does NOT affect next level at all. Inside a stage it
should help to be fast though, you would be allmost finished your task
(diagonals etc) when tiles become fast...if that is time dependent.

<p>

Hisa's patterns are somewhat theoretical, requiring too much one
colour/joker-tile. Trying those will ruin the fun in Klax in my
opinion. That's also a good reason to play prototype. I don't think
there is any record for prototype, because it is prototype ;)

<p>

5 jokers would be enormous luck+so much same colour...
You can not even be sure to get one joker-tile/stage.
If you don't get past some stage, and start same stage again with new
credit-you will get easier tiles, more jokers. Multiple credits is
not allowed at MARP though.

More research... this time for the klax prototype.<p>

Wave Series Start--Klaxs-Tiles-Points-Diagonals-Tiles-Points-Klaxs-
Tiles-Points<p>

1--3-40-10000-5-50-15000-10-60-20000<br>
10--15-75-25000-13-75-25000-15-75-25000<br>
19--20-65-30000-13-75-30000-30-80-30000<br>
28--30-90-40000-13-90-40000-30-90-40000<br>
37--40-90-50000-13-90-50000-40-90-50000<br>
46--40-90-60000-13-90-60000-40-90-60000<br>
Anything that was klaxs are now diagonals<br>
55--13-100-70000-13-100-70000-13-100-70000<br>
64--13-100-80000-13-100-80000-13-100-80000<br>
73--20-100-90000-20-100-90000-20-100-90000<br>
82--13-100-50000-13-100-60000-13-100-70000<br>
91--20-100-100000-30-100-100000-40-100-100000<p>
Level 100 - Score 500,000 points. Yeah... 500,000 points. Good
luck... with the lesser scoring system than the offical release.

Oh, pppth. 500k isn't THAT hard to pull off on the prototype. You
just have to remember that it's basically a 100-diagonals stage.
(Well... maybe 90 diagonals, if you add in the 5 points per tile...)
